The requirements for the construction of new buildings should be verified. In<br />

many cases it is more suitable to use already existing buildings, if they can meet the<br />

space requirements, then to demolish the existing building <strong>and</strong> to build a new one.<br />

Existing assets can be converted <strong>and</strong> often also extended, if there is more space<br />

required. The energy consumption caused by cooling, heating <strong>and</strong> lighting can be<br />

minimised by modification of the existing building structure, the attachment of<br />

relevant components <strong>and</strong> the replacement of inefficient components of the technical<br />

building equipment.<br />

There are two general possibilities for a building site, if a new building is required.<br />

The utilisation of a former already covered site (e.g. post- industrial or military sites)<br />

should be always preferred compared to a site on the green field to protect the natural<br />

environment as much as possible. In any case the site should be surveyed concerning<br />

potential contamination with hazardous substances <strong>and</strong> eventually recycled to protect<br />

the natural environment (e.g. related to soil quality, groundwater quality protection<br />

<strong>and</strong> gas emissions) as well as the human health.<br />
